Solution for 5x^2-17x+40=0 equation:


Simplifying
5x2 + -17x + 40 = 0

Reorder the terms:
40 + -17x + 5x2 = 0

Solving
40 + -17x + 5x2 = 0

Solving for variable 'x'.

Begin completing the square.  Divide all terms by
5 the coefficient of the squared term: 

Divide each side by '5'.
8 + -3.4x + x2 = 0

Move the constant term to the right:

Add '-8' to each side of the equation.
8 + -3.4x + -8 + x2 = 0 + -8

Reorder the terms:
8 + -8 + -3.4x + x2 = 0 + -8

Combine like terms: 8 + -8 = 0
0 + -3.4x + x2 = 0 + -8
-3.4x + x2 = 0 + -8

Combine like terms: 0 + -8 = -8
-3.4x + x2 = -8

The x term is -3.4x.  Take half its coefficient (-1.7).
Square it (2.89) and add it to both sides.

Add '2.89' to each side of the equation.
-3.4x + 2.89 + x2 = -8 + 2.89

Reorder the terms:
2.89 + -3.4x + x2 = -8 + 2.89

Combine like terms: -8 + 2.89 = -5.11
2.89 + -3.4x + x2 = -5.11

Factor a perfect square on the left side:
(x + -1.7)(x + -1.7) = -5.11

Can't calculate square root of the right side.

The solution to this equation could not be determined.
